Abstract

A marker fired by commands from a remote location for hunting games such as a paintball gun or a laser gun used in laser tag. The marker is controller by a variety of control systems, both open loop and closed loop. Such control systems allow remote error detection and correction of the projectiles of the markers.

1 . A remotely operated marker for use in a participatory hunting sport game comprising:
 a) a marking element;   b) a means for projecting said marking element using an electrical input signal applied to said remotely operated marker and generated in response to a command;   c) a means for receiving a first data signal indicative of a characteristic of said remotely operated marker at a first location remote from said remotely operated marker; and   d) a means for electronically comparing said command to a second data signal derived from said first data signal at said first remote location and for altering said electrical input signal in response to said comparison.   
   
   
       2 . A remotely operated marker in accordance with  claim 1  wherein said marker is a paintball gun. 
   
   
       3 . A remotely operated marker in accordance with  claim 1  wherein said marker is a laser-tag gun. 
   
   
       4 . A remotely operated marker in accordance with  claim 2  wherein said characteristic comprises at least one of:
 a) whether or not said marker can project said marking element in response to said second data signal;   b) a gas pressure in said marker;   c) the number of marking elements held by said marker; and   d) if said marker has been disabled in response to the projection of a marking element by another marker.   
   
   
       5 . A remotely operated marker in accordance with  claim 1  including a remote trigger for issuing firing commands to a remotely operated marker, said remote trigger comprising:
 a) a trigger device at a location remote from said marker; and   b) a means proximate and responsive to said trigger device for transmitting a signal to said marker.   
   
   
       6 . A remotely operated marker in accordance with  claim 1  wherein said marker is mounted to a mobility assistance device. 
   
   
       7 . A remotely operated marker in accordance with  claim 6  wherein said mobility assistance device is a wheelchair. 
   
   
       8 . A remote trigger in accordance with  claim 5  wherein said trigger device is held in the mouth of a participant. 
   
   
       9 . A remotely operated marker in accordance with  claim 6  wherein said mobility assistance device is used by a person with a physical disability.
